I have a network set up on Windows XP Home. My desktop is connected to a
router and the laptop is wireless. They both access the internet fine. I
can print from my laptop to a printer connected to the desktop. I can access
all files on the desktop from the laptop...but, I can not access any laptop
files from the desktop. I receive the following error, "You might not have
permission to use this network resource. Contact the administrator of this
server to find out if you have access permissions. Access is denied."
I have gone to the Properties section of the folders in my laptop that I
would like to share and have checked "Share this folder on the network" and
"Allow network users to change my files."
I'm stumped. Any help would be greatly appreciated!
